Mistral released Leanstral-1.5-119B-A6B
View original on reddit.comSummary
Leanstral 1.5, a free Apache-2.0 licensed model with 6B active parameters, delivers a major performance upgrade in formal verification, saturating miniF2F, solving 587/672 PutnamBench problems, and achieving state-of-the-art results on FATE-H (87%) and FATE-X (34%). Trained through mid-training, supervised fine-tuning, and reinforcement learning with CISPO, it excels in agentic proof engineering and real-world code verification, uncovering 5 previously unknown bugs across 57 repositories tested.
